The bones of victims of the 1915 #Armenian genocide on display at a small memorial chapel in Antelias, #Lebanon. During World War I, the leaders of the Ottoman Empire worried that its Christian Armenian population was planning to align with Russia, a primary enemy. So they embarked on what historians have called the first genocide of the 20th century. Nearly 1.5 million Armenians were killed. But in #Turkey, most people don’t talk about it. “How do you photograph the memory of something that has been attempted to be scrubbed from the place?” said @bdentonphoto, who shot photos for a story about the 100th anniversary of the massacre, which is April 24. #nytweekender
